Get started89 Boulton Street is a semi-detached house in Stoke On Trent (ST1 2NQ).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2021) shows an E (score 42),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 3-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ced Stoke On Trent HPI: 111.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£144,000 is 10.8%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£173/sq ft) was about 112.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 86% of similar EPCs). Most recent transfer: October 2022 at £130,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
89 Boulton Street's carbon output runs well above what efficient homes in the postcode produce.
Latest sale on 89 Boulton Street was the highest on Land Registry record across the postcode.
